When Connectivity Puts Production and Safety at Risk

Industrial environments place extreme demands on wireless networks. Coverage gaps, latency, or unplanned outages can stop production lines, delay vessel or yard operations, disrupt energy output, and increase safety risk for workers in active industrial zones.

While requirements vary across sectors, these environments share a common challenge: most legacy wireless networks were never designed to support today’s scale, mobility, automation, and real‑time operational systems.

Manufacturing

Manufacturing operations increasingly rely on automation, robotics, and real-time data. Common challenges include:

Inconsistent connectivity on production floors

Legacy Wi-Fi systems that cannot support low-latency or deterministic performance

Limited visibility into equipment health and process data

Difficulty upgrading networks without disrupting active production

Manufacturers need private cellular networks that deliver reliability, control, and room to scale.

Ports

Ports operate as high-density, always-on environments with moving assets and large outdoor footprints. Key challenges include:

Inconsistent coverage across yards, terminals, and warehouses

High device mobility involving vehicles, cranes, scanners, and personnel

Congestion and interference impacting legacy wireless systems

Growing automation and tracking requirements

Ports require resilient wireless infrastructure that supports coordination, safety, and throughput at scale.

Energy

Energy operations span wide geographies and critical infrastructure. Common pain points include:

Distributed assets that are difficult to connect reliably

Operational systems requiring secure, low-latency communications

Strict safety and regulatory requirements

Real-time monitoring needs across facilities and field operations

Energy providers require secure, resilient wireless networks that support both reliability and modernization.

Mining

Mining pushes connectivity into remote and physically demanding conditions. Typical challenges include:

Limited or nonexistent public network coverage

Harsh environments that strain traditional infrastructure

Safety-critical communications for workers and vehicles

Support for autonomous or remotely operated equipment

Mining organizations increasingly turn to private LTE and 5G to enable safer, more efficient operations.
